The diffuse cosmic and the vertical atmospheric component of 1-20 MeV gamma rays are determined from the gamma-ray data obtained during a balloon flight of the large-area Compton telescope of the Max-Planck-Institut. It is shown that the basic improvement of this new measurement above previous measurements with a first version of the Compton telescope is based on the fact that for each registered event various additional parameters are determined. Further, by means of the pulse shape measurement of neutron-induced events it is possible to determine most of the undesired background events from the data themselves. Finally, consideration is given to the origin of the diffuse cosmic gamma-ray component, and the results of the atmospheric gamma-ray component are compared with different model calculations.
